For those who want to know I had a problem with my Sony 50inch W800C constantly restarting when left turned on. It was not due to eco mode, power saving mode etc, which were turned off. It just kept restarting haphazardly when in analog TV mode, in Play store, when going thru my settings menu, playing youtube videos etc. Some time it would be a few minutes between restarts, sometimes, 20-30min or more. Firmware was the latest according to the settings menu.
So I kpkb and got just the set exchanged. I ran the exchange set for hours over the weekend using the same power adapter and wall socket. No restarts, yay... And I even fed back to the Sony service guy who called that all was ok.
But last night, it all restarted again....
The first time it restarted, it took at least 1-2 mins to restart again, and even then it stuttered A LOT in its UI and when showing analog TV. It also could not detect any wifi signal, not even from the neighbours.
So I turned off the wall socket, waited a while and turned on again. Turned on the TV again, now it can detect and connect to wifi. However, restart restart restart, I think at least 5-6 times within 30mins. I check the firmware status, it's the latest. I also note that its in auto update mode. But I dunno when/if a firmware update had occurred, if the latest firmware is what caused the bug to reoccur.
Next day, I change tactics, I change the plug to the adjacent wall socket that my modem and router are using. I never had appearing and disappearing wifi signal on my phone and laptop in my house, so that wall socket is confirm no problem. However, restart still occurred within 10+mins.
